2 out of hospital after Texas petroleum facility fire

| December 6, 2020 4:32 PM

CORPUS CHRISTI, Texas (AP) — Two of the seven workers injured when a storage tank at a petroleum facility in Texas exploded after catching fire have been released from the hospital, while the remaining five are hospitalized in stable condition, officials said Sunday.
